No-code vs. low-code: Hva passer best for digital utvikling og IT-strategi?

I en tid der stadig flere vurderer no-code og low-code som alternativer til tradisjonell programvareutvikling, blir det viktig å forstå hvordan disse metodene passer inn i en helhetlig IT-strategi. Temaet har de siste årene fått mye oppmerksomhet, og det med god grunn. Teknologiene lover raskere utvikling, lavere kostnader og kortere vei fra idé til produkt. Men er det egentlig løsningen på alt? Eller kan snarveien bli kostbar i lengden?
I denne artikkelen ser vi nærmere på hva no-code og low-code egentlig er, hvem det passer for, og når det kanskje ikke er veien å gå.
Hva betyr no-code og low-code?
- No-code: Bygge digitale løsninger uten å skrive kode.
- Low-code: Bygge med minimale mengder kode, men fortsatt med noe teknisk innsats.
Begge tilnærmingene gjør det mulig å utvikle applikasjoner raskere, ofte gjennom visuelle verktøy og ferdige byggeklosser. Mange plattformer, som PowerApps, OutSystems og Bubble, lar både utviklere og ikke-utviklere lage løsninger uten å måtte starte fra scratch.
Når fungerer det?
Det er lett å forstå hvorfor denne trenden har fått fotfeste. For mange selskaper er det et stort behov for å:
- Digitalisere manuelle prosesser
- Få ut interne verktøy raskt
- Lage prototyper for testing
- Tilby enkel funksjonalitet for avgrensede behov
I slike tilfeller er no-code og low-code et glimrende verktøy. Det kan redusere time-to-market betraktelig og gjøre det mulig for f.eks. HR eller salg å få sine behov løst uten å stå i kø hos IT-avdelingen. Samtidig får man testet ut nye verktøy, flyter og hypoteser fort og billig.
Når er det ikke nok?
Men som med andre revolusjonerende teknologier finnes det også begrensninger.
Et no code-system er sjelden en fullverdig erstatning for skreddersydd utvikling når man skal bygge komplekse tjenester med høy integrasjonsgrad, mange brukere eller behov for skalerbarhet og sikkerhet.
No code-plattformer er ofte:
- Vanskelige å integrere med eksisterende systemer
- Lite fleksible når behovene vokser
- Avhengige av leverandørens rammer og lisensmodeller
Mange selskaper opplever også teknisk gjeld senere, når løsningen ikke kan tilpasses videre uten betydelige ombygginger.
Et strategisk spørsmål, ikke bare et teknisk valg
Valget mellom no-code og tradisjonell utvikling handler ikke bare om fart og kostnad. Det handler om langsiktig kontroll, skalerbarhet og eierskap.
Still deg derfor følgende spørsmål:
- Er dette en midlertidig løsning eller en sentral del av vår forretningskritiske plattform?
- Trenger vi fleksibilitet og kontroll over arkitektur og data?
- Har vi kompetansen internt til å forvalte og videreutvikle løsningen?
Hvis svaret på ett eller flere av disse er "ja", er det verdt å vurdere om low/no-code faktisk er riktig vei.
Hva bør du velge, og når?
No-code og low-code gir fart og tilgjengelighet, men krever bevisste valg for å passe inn i helheten. Hos Seven Peaks anbefaler vi ofte en balansert tilnærming:
- Low-code egner seg godt til intern automatisering, enkle skjema og støtteprosesser innen applikasjonsutvikling – eller som verktøy i POC-er og MVP-er.
- Skreddersydd utvikling passer bedre for kjerneprodukter og kundevendte plattformer med høy kompleksitet, krav til fleksibilitet og tydelig eierskap.
Ofte handler det ikke om enten/eller, men om hva som skal bygges hvor, og hvorfor.
Vil du lese mer om hvordan vi kombinerer ferdige byggeklosser med skreddersøm? Ta en titt på artikkelen Skreddersøm eller hyllevare.
Vil du heller hoppe rett til en prat om hva som passer best i din strategi? Ta kontakt her, så ser vi på helheten sammen.
Heading 1
Heading 2
Heading 3
Heading 4
Heading 5
Heading 6
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.
Block quote
Ordered list
- Item 1
- Item 2
- Item 3
Unordered list
- Item A
- Item B
- Item C
Bold text
Emphasis
Superscript
Subscript